Mental Health in Australia

One in five Australians aged 16 to 85 experience a mental health condition each year (AIWH), increasing the need for skilled Mental Health Workers across community, residential, and outreach settings.

Around 5,700 mental health social workers and occupational therapists are employed in Australia (AIWH), reflecting strong demand for skilled professionals delivering recovery-focused support services.

There are over 9,600 Mental Health Worker roles currently listed on SEEK across Australia, reflecting strong ongoing recruitment demand in community mental health, support services, and care roles.
